B2B2C 电商系统构建优化策略:从架构设计到运营落地

在数字经济深度融合的背景下,B2B2C 电商系统作为连接企业、商户与消费者的核心枢纽,其构建需兼顾多角色需求与复杂业务场景。本文从技术架构、功能模块、实施路径等维度,系统阐述构建高性能、高可用电商平台的核心策略,结合行业最佳实践与前沿技术,提供可落地的解决方案。​

一、系统架构设计:分层解耦与微服务化架构​

(一)技术选型与分布式架构设计​

采用Spring Cloud Alibaba/Dubbo 微服务架构体系,实现核心业务模块的服务化拆分与独立部署。通过 Nacos 完成服务注册与配置管理,借助 Seata 分布式事务框架解决跨服务数据一致性问题(如订单创建时的库存扣减与支付同步)。数据库层采用混合架构:MySQL/PostgreSQL 处理结构化交易数据,MongoDB 存储商品详情等非结构化信息,Redis 集群构建高速缓存层,实现热点数据的毫秒级响应。​

前端体系采用技术栈分层策略:供应商管理端基于 Vue 3+Element Plus 构建,提供高效的后台操作界面;消费者端采用 React+Ant Design 实现,适配多端交互需求;跨平台场景通过 Electron 框架开发桌面应用,覆盖全终端用户触达。​

(二)多租户隔离与国际化支持​

实施三级租户隔离机制:通过数据库分库(物理隔离)、分表(逻辑隔离)结合租户 ID 字段(数据标签),确保不同供应商的数据安全与业务独立,如美团外卖商家端的独立数据空间设计。国际化模块集成 i18next 语言包管理系统,支持动态加载多语言资源文件,结合 Currency.js 实现实时汇率计算与展示,满足亚马逊级别的全球化运营需求(支持 18 种语言及 50 + 货币结算)。​

二、核心功能模块:全链路业务闭环构建​

(一)交易体系深度设计​

  1. 商品管理系统构建 SKU 级精细化管理模块,支持多规格商品组合发布、动态价格策略配置(如京东第三方商家的独立定价体系与平台限价规则)。集成 Elasticsearch 搜索引擎,实现商品智能检索与关联推荐,通过分词算法优化搜索命中率,降低用户检索成本。​
  1. 订单履约系统采用
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值